Leicester City's fall is a testament to the fragility of football success.
What happened?
Leicester City, former Premier League champions, are on the brink of a catastrophic fall to League One.
Some argue that Leicester City's decline is an opportunity for rebuilding and long-term stability, rather than a sign of systemic failure in football management.
The risk of financial instability and loss of talent looms large if Leicester City does indeed drop out of the Premier League.
Owners and sponsors may prioritize short-term gains over long-term investment, exacerbating the club's problems.
If Leicester City fails to stabilize quickly, it could set a precedent for other clubs facing similar challenges in balancing ambition with fiscal responsibility.
Relegation seems likely unless significant changes are made immediately. The club's future depends on swift and decisive action.
